I think you have to drill three holes in the sprocket and attach it to the wheel mounting. The sprocket sort of becomes part of the wheel, and is not directly connected to the shaft. Anyway, this is what we did. We had a heck of a time getting the holes in the right place, though. Better get some advice from a good machinist.
